Ep. 19: Thinking out loud with HH Sheikha Intisar AlSabah

from The #Diplowomen Podcast · host Karma Ekmekji

In episode 19 of The #Diplowomen Podcast, Karma Ekmekji thinks out loud with HH Sheikha Intisar AlSabah, Social Entrepreneur, Philanthropist, Author and Film Producer and the Founder and Chairwoman of Intisar Foundation focusing on the mental health of women in the Arab World. 00:00 Introduction 02:00 Work, passion and vision 08:58 Drama therapy and its valuable tools 13:42 A personal experience of Kuwait’s Invasion 17:22 Psychological health and its impact on peace-building efforts in the Arab World 21:35 A 30-year vision: supporting one million Arab Women 27:30 Men and mental health 29:00 Entering the World of Drama Therapy: Where to begin?
